It is a model 3667 from the 1940s which has lost its lugs and someone turned it into a pendant. At this point unless it has some historical value then it is basically only worth its weight in gold.
You could try and find an original back case with the lugs still attached which would make it a really nice wearer. Im afraid trying to obtain that back case may be near impossible.
